Osogovo Bay
Osogovo Bay (Osogovski Zaliv \o-so-'gov-ski 'za-liv\) is bounded by the south coast of Rugged Island, by Astor Island, and by the west coast of the Byers Peninsula south of Laager Point, Livingston Island, Antarctica.
It is entered between Benson Point and Devils Point, and is named after the Osogovo region in western Bulgaria.
